This document is a public procurement notice from Gmina Pisz for the construction of a video surveillance system, with offers to be submitted electronically.
This document contains a bidder's declaration confirming the current validity of information provided in a previous statement for the "Construction of video surveillance" tender.
This document is a tender offer form for the construction of a video surveillance system, requiring bidders to provide company details, pricing, delivery timelines, warranty information, and declarations.
This document contains a bidder's declaration confirming they meet participation conditions and are not subject to exclusion from the public procurement procedure for the construction of a video surveillance system.
This document is a declaration by a resource-providing entity for the "Construction of a video surveillance system" tender, confirming they are not subject to exclusion and meet participation requirements.
This document is an annex to the tender specifications, requiring bidders to provide a list of completed construction works related to the "Construction of visual monitoring" tender, along with supporting evidence.
This document is a form template requiring the bidder to list personnel who will participate in the execution of the visual monitoring system construction project, including their qualifications and roles.
This document contains a commitment from a resource-providing entity to make its resources available to the bidder for the "Construction of visual monitoring" tender.
This document is an affidavit required from bidders, as per Article 117(4) of the Public Procurement Law, to declare which construction works will be jointly performed by entities bidding together for the "Construction of video surveillance" project.
This document contains the draft contract provisions for the construction of a visual monitoring system, detailing the subject of the contract, materials, and implementation deadlines.

This tender for the construction of a video surveillance system in Gmina Pisz presents a generally well-structured procurement process with good documentation, though value disclosure and explicit evaluation criteria are missing. The reliance on e-procurement is positive, but the short submission deadline and lack of sustainability focus are notable concerns.
The tender adheres to general public procurement regulations, including a proper CPV code and a specified procedure type ('None' code is unusual but likely indicates a standard procedure). However, the lack of a clearly stated reveal date for offers and the absence of explicit evaluation criteria raise minor concerns regarding procedural transparency. No disputes are reported.
The tender title and basic description are clear, and the AI-extracted requirements indicate a structured approach to defining needs. The provision of numerous required annexes and a contract draft further enhances clarity for potential bidders. The 'Program funkjonalno-użytkowy' document remains unsummarized, which could be a minor point of confusion.
Most essential information such as title, reference, organization, location, CPV code, contract duration, and a submission deadline are present. A significant number of tender documents are available, including various mandatory forms and the contract draft. However, the estimated value is not disclosed, which impacts overall completeness.
The tender utilizes e-procurement, ensuring broad access. All documents are generally available, and the common CPV code suggests a standard approach rather than tailored requirements. The disclosure of contract duration and the fact that the value is not classified indicate a reasonable level of transparency. The lack of specific evaluation criteria is a slight detraction.
The tender is an e-procurement process, which is a positive for submission. However, the submission deadline of March 31, 2026, for a tender published on March 13, 2026 (implied by the date), is very short (18 days), potentially hindering bidder preparation. Financing information and contract start date are not explicitly provided.
Key fields such as title, reference, organization, and deadline are consistently populated. The status is 'active,' and no disputes are reported, indicating a stable and ongoing process. The dates are logically presented. The CPV code and NUTS code are provided, contributing to data coherence.
There is no explicit mention of green procurement criteria, social aspects, innovation, or EU funding in the provided information, suggesting a standard procurement rather than one with sustainability objectives.
